Overkill Has Another adidas ZX 10.000C Collaboration Coming

Overkill Has Another adidas ZX 10.000C Collaboration Coming

When they last got together, Overkill and adidas cooked up one of the best Three Stripes creations in recent memory, adding a boisterous color scheme to the ZX 10.000C silhouette with a bit of a twist. Instead of coming with two sneakers like just about every other release in human history, this extended box equipped a different-colored third shoe that varied between a left or a right depending on the box. While that unprecedented pairing never released at retail as it was reserved for friends and family, the two German sneaker titans are back on the 10.000C once again with a more conventional collaboration that fuses together shades of grey with blue, red, green, and more. In an effort to bring a premium aesthetic into the fold, Overkill has opted to blend together buttery suede with a perforated mesh netting, rubber, and a terrycloth-like instep. With pairs expected to drop on April 6th, grab a first look ahead and stay tuned for updates as the release date fast approaches.

Overkill x adidas ZX 10.000C
Release Date: April 6th, 2019 (Overkill)
Release Date: April 12th, 2019 (Global)
€160
Style Code: G26252
